OVERVIEW
The MD61 Rudder Angle Transmitter is a Rudder Angle Transducer for providing steering indication. Mounted in the steering compartment, it transmits the vessel’s Rudder Angle to a Marine Data Rudder Angle Indicator. The input shaft is mechanically linked to the vessel’s rudder stock by a fully adjustable linkage rod (supplied).
The MD61 has dual outputs:
- Digital NMEA 0183 and
- Analogue Variable Voltage (via 5 KΩ geared potentiometer
The Rudder Angle Transmitter is fully sealed and housed in a robust aluminium alloy enclosure. Finished in Window Grey semi-gloss paint to complement other marine navigation equipment.

FEATURES
- Ship’s Rudder Angle Sensor and Transmitter
- Digital NMEA 0183 Output (IEC 61162-1)
- Analogue Variable Voltage Output – 5 KΩ Potentiometer
- Built-in Rudder Indication LEDs for easy set-up
- Fully Adjustable Rudder Linkage Rod
- Proven Rugged Design
- Type Approval: Wheel Mark (0098-14) when installed as part of the Marine Data Rudder Angle Indicator System
APPLICATIONS
- Transmits Rudder Angle data to a Marine Data Rudder Angle Indicator, VDR or Auto-Pilot at any convenient location
